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Adopt go modules #81

Merged
merged 1 commit into from
Feb 5, 2021
Merged

Adopt go modules #81

merged 1 commit into from
Feb 5, 2021

Conversation

rmfitzpatrick
Copy link
Contributor

@rmfitzpatrick rmfitzpatrick commented Dec 9, 2020

In an attempt to satisfy #70 these changes adopt go modules and move the example content to a new github.com/soheily/cmux/example* module.

@ptabor
Copy link

ptabor commented Jan 8, 2021

Please merge this change.

It's significant problem for etcd that, fact that we depend of cmux is adding wide set of additional undesired dependencies,
in particular: google.golang.org/grpc/examples/helloworld/helloworld, that transitively brings unwanted version of grpc or protos.

@ptabor
Copy link

ptabor commented Jan 30, 2021

@soheilhy Could you, please, comment on perspectives to have it merged (or in different way isolate transitive dependencies coming from the example) ?

@soheilhy
Copy link
Owner

Happy to merge this. @rmfitzpatrick can you please rebase and resolve the conflict?

@rmfitzpatrick
Copy link
Contributor Author

@soheilhy, updated, thanks for your patience and review.

@soheilhy
Copy link
Owner

soheilhy commented Feb 5, 2021

/thanks!

@soheilhy soheilhy merged commit 5ec6847 into soheilhy:master Feb 5,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ants